Women of the Diaspora | Feat. Bishop Vashti Murphy McKenzie

In Conversation with Kenya Dunn

Join us for Women of the Diaspora, a dynamic program series honoring woman of African descent who are breaking barriers and paving the way for future generations. This Women’s History Month, we are proud to feature Bishop Vashti Murphy McKenzie, the first woman elected Bishop in the AME Church, in conversation with Kenya Dunn, entrepreneur and founder of the Power-Filled Woman.

Together, they’ll explore themes of faith, perseverance, and empathy, reflecting on their groundbreaking journeys and the importance of empowering young women to lead with authenticity and purpose. Bishop McKenzie’s visionary leadership and Kenya Dunn’s commitment to fostering transformational success create a powerful dialogue about redefining leadership and inspiring the next generation.
